Symbols Explained
ts2 Tongue Strap vs2 Visor hd2 Hood es2 Eye Shield ec2 Eye Cover cp2 Cheekpiece bl2 Blinkers tt2 Tongue Tie bf Beaten Favourite on Last Run srMentioned in Stewards Report in Results bbvBroke Blood Vessel
The superscript number on headgear bl2 indicates number of times worn. A plus bl+ indicates more than 10 times where as red background bl1indicates first time.

After race at Tramore Tue, 6th Dec, 2022 (1st)
It's great to win this race named in honour of John Kiely. We've had plenty to do with John over the years. He spoke up for me when I was getting my licence and I've galloped horses at his place. With the casualties at the third last you don't know what would have happened, but Conor thinks he had loads of horse underneath him. He won well. Conor didn't even realise there was loose horses until they came at him at the second last. He thought it was a horse sneaking up his inner. He ran well the last day in Limerick and I haven't done a whole lot with him in the two weeks since. He got a mark of 95 and this was his first handicap obviously. I think he is a nice horse and we've always thought a lot of him. I'm surprised he didn't win a bumper in the summer but I think mentally he just wasn't there. He is getting there now and that ground is exactly what he wants. He'd plough away through it all day. He might go to Limerick but we will see what the handicapper does. We won't spend too long over hurdles, I'd say he will jump a fence.
N Dooly
